Output 18056ccd0effffbf1be65b3e7040a5556cd0ada71f1f3ada8564972075dabcfa:0

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af2f99e0410c41e403640ad66fd8870f64640aa OP_EQUAL
address
374iBscvcRTqhfzhQbTYREBqQkb2SiCnaF
transaction
18056ccd0effffbf1be65b3e7040a5556cd0ada71f1f3ada8564972075dabcfa
confirmations
214424
spent
true